This project investigates the connection between metabolism and gene expression by exploring how certain metabolic enzymes function as RNA-binding proteins. It aims to uncover the mRNA interactomes in eukaryotic cells, revealing how metabolic states influence RNA interactions and gene regulation.
The question of how (intermediary) metabolism and the regulation of gene expression are inter-connected represents one of the central challenges for the next decade of research.
This proposal aims to take a decisive stab at this question, exploiting hidden gems from the literature and modern day technologies.Some metabolic enzymes have been caught “moonlighting” as RNA-binding proteins and, intriguingly, their RNA-binding activities appear to be under the control of metabolites and/or cofactors…
